在当前高速发展的网络时代,服务器管理工具显得尤为重要,它们不仅简化了管理过程,还提高了效率和稳定性,这些工具帮助管理员监控服务器状态、性能,自动部署配置,并提供及时的故障通知,保障系统的顺畅运行,以下是一些快速的服务器管理工具介绍:
1、Zabbix
功能描述:Zabbix是一款功能强大的开源监控工具,它支持多种操作系统和网络设备,能够监控服务器的性能、可用性和各种指标,以及提供数据可视化的功能。
主要特点:Zabbix提供实时告警和通知功能,当服务器出现异常状况时,可以及时通知管理员采取相应的措施。
2、Nagios
功能描述:Nagios是一款流行的开源监控工具,用于监控服务器的网络流量、硬件状态、服务可用性等,并可根据用户需求进行灵活配置。
主要特点:Nagios提供强大的报警功能,可以通过电子邮件、短信等多种方式及时通知管理员。
3、Prometheus
功能描述:Prometheus是一个开源的监控和警告工具,它存储实时的服务运行指标,并提供查询语言来进行数据检索。
主要特点:使用PromQL进行数据查询与聚合,可对接第三方图表和警报工具。
4、Puppet
功能描述:Puppet是一款开源的自动化服务器管理工具,通过声明式语言描述系统状态,实现自动化部署和管理。
主要特点:提供易于理解和管理的Web界面,方便管理员进行集中控制和监控。
5、Ansible
功能描述:Ansible使用SSH协议通信,通过声明式语言来定义服务器配置和状态,实现简单的集中配置管理。
主要特点:易用且无需在被管理服务器上安装客户端,适合远程服务器管理。
6、Chef
功能描述:Chef允许管理员使用Ruby语言编写脚本来实现对服务器集群的配置和自动化管理。
主要特点:具有强大的扩展性和灵活性,可与其他工具集成,适应不同管理需求。
7、SaltStack
功能描述:SaltStack使用Python开发,通过在服务器上安装客户端实现对大量服务器的集中管理。
主要特点:提供强大的并发性能和基于事件驱动的架构,实时响应服务器状态变化。
8、Cobbler
功能描述:Cobbler自动化Linux系统的安装和配置,通过网络同时处理大量服务器的部署和维护。
主要特点:支持多种Linux发行版,提供友好的Web界面和命令行操作。
9、YafServerAdmin
功能描述:专为Yaf框架设计的服务器管理工具,提供日志查看、性能监控和配置调整等功能。
主要特点:提高开发者工作效率,简化服务器管理任务。
选择合适的服务器管理工具对于确保IT基础设施的高效和稳定运行至关重要,从Zabbix到YafServerAdmin,不同的工具有其独特的优势和用途,而合理的选择和应用可以显著提升服务器管理的效率和质量。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1015658.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复